Headache is one of the symptoms of bronchitis.
It is the respiratory stress in bronchitis (difficulties breathing, coughing), that often leads to impaired sleep, which triggers headache.
It is very possible that you have sinusitis at the same time.
Actually, bronchitis is very common following a sinus infection due to the post-nasal drip of thickened mucus reaching the bronchi.
Severe headache, along with facial pain and pressure, are characteristics of sinusitis.
Very often, these conditions need proper antibiotic treatment.
Left untreated may cause complications.
